“The First Lady of Exotic,” Chef Gina Onyx is the creative force behind Komodo Kitchen—where art, spice, and storytelling intertwine in every dish. Her acclaimed Detroit pop-ups—often whispered about as
“the hottest table in town”—captivate guests through every sense:
sight, scent, sound, and soul. Chef Gina brought that mystical island magic to The Pavilion Street Market Ferndale for two unforgettable nights of culinary and cultural exploration.
The exclusive five-course dinner featured her signature Nasi Rendang—the celebrated Sumatran coconut-braised dish that captured the world’s attention when a CNN International poll named Beef Rendang the #1 Most Delicious Food in the World, and Chef Gordon Ramsay hailed it as “a masterpiece of slow-cooked perfection.”
From the fragrance of ylang-ylang, jasmine, pandan, and lemongrass to the vibrant greens of Gado Gado and the deep, earthy spices of Rendang—each course is a love letter to Indonesia’s 15,000-island archipelago, served Komodo-style: warm, intimate, and rich with story.

Robert Daleski of MetroPalate Events invites you to join Fleur de Mer,
A six course dinner indulgence that taps into the palate of established seafood lovers & the culinarily seafood curious.
Indulge in handcrafted Snow Crab Ravioli drizzled with a rich Sherry cream, delicately poached Halibut on top of refreshingly savory Cucumber Risotto, the briny clam driven flavor of Rhode Island Clam Chowder,
and the crunch and umami experience of the Prawn Toast
Finished with the lush indulgence of the Burmese Semolina cake drizzled with a refreshing lemon shiso anglaise.

We brought A Christmas Story to life with an immersive dining experience unlike anything you've ever seen. For one magical
month only, our space transforms into the world of Ralphie,
the Old Man, and the beloved characters who made this film
an unforgettable holiday tradition.
Enjoy a festive five-course family dinner or indulge in an elevated seven-course feast with friends, all while the movie plays around you in an atmosphere straight out of the 1940s holiday season. You’ll test your knowledge with themed trivia, encounter surprise moments from the film, and even be served by characters you know and love. This is not just dinner—it's a nostalgic journey filled with laughter, storytelling, and cinematic wonder.
